Obama’s Leadership Style Put to Test

President Barack Obama makes a statement on AIG, on the South Lawn of the White House in Washington, Mar. 18, 2009. U.S. President Barack Obama has been in office two months now, and the ongoing economic crisis is putting his leadership skills to the test. It was a challenging week for a new president focused on restoring public confidence in an economy that remains uncertain.
